## Further Reading

Snapshot testing is how we guard the Bramblebox component library against unintended visual changes. Each component renders to a serialized tree, and CI fails when output drifts from the stored snapshot. New team members should understand when to update snapshots deliberately versus investigating a regression — blindly re-recording defeats the purpose. We keep a guide covering snapshot hygiene, review etiquette, and common flaky-render causes. Before your first snapshot-related review, read the internal page linked below.

wiki page, tagef-kahop: https://artifactory.xolmartech.internal/browse/dash/build/dash/2cc0ce10c67daee1

**Slow template rendering in Veldrome CMS.** Symptom: p95 render times above 800ms on the partials-heavy checkout pages. Cause: template cache disabled after the Quillgate 4.2 upgrade reset config defaults. Fix: re-enable `cache_compiled: true` and restart workers. Verify via the metrics endpoint on the render tier. Authenticated requests to that endpoint require the bearer token shown below.

session JWT of yawep-yawep = eyJhbGciOiJIUzI1NiIsInR5cCI6IkpXVCJ9.eyJzdWIiOiI3pWF3_In0.aXYsHiog

# Break-Glass: Catalog Cache Invalidation

Scope: the Pinrow product catalog at Veldstone Retail. If stale prices persist after a purge and the Hollowmere invalidation queue is wedged, use break-glass to flush the edge tier directly. Contractors: get verbal sign-off from the catalog lead first. Steps: open the Hollowmere admin shell, select emergency-flush, confirm the tenant, and run it once — repeated flushes thrash the origin. Access is logged and expires after 20 minutes. Unseal the admin shell with the passphrase below.

recovery phrase for kahop-tajog: istix-casvan